Big B garners 20 million Twitter followers


Mumbai, Mar 23 (IANS): Megastar Amitabh Bachchan has become the first Bollywood personality to score 20 million followers on Twitter and has thanked his fans and well-wishers on reaching the milestone.

The 73-year-old thespian, who has given hits like "Sholay", "Deewar" and "Piku", is ahead of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i, who has 18.8 million followers, as well as actors Shah Rukh Khan with 18.6 million, Aamir Khan 16.9 million, Salman Khan 16.8 million and Priyanka Chopra with 13.2 million followers respectively.

Big B took to Twitter on Tuesday night to express his excitement of getting 20 million followers on the micro-blogging website.

"Badumba! 20 million! Thank you all... Now to 30 million! And your time starts now!" Amitabh tweeted.

Amitabh's Twitter account went live in May 2010, and the actor has ever since been staying in connection with his fans, whom he fondly calls his "ef" or his "extended family".

On the work front, Amitabh will next be seen in "TE3N" directed by debutant Ribhu Dasgupta. The film also features actors Vidya Balan and Nawazuddin Siddiqui.

He is currently busy shooting for Shoojit Sircar's next production venture "Pink."
